Ipsotek is pleased to announce the appointment of Ara Babayan as Chief Operating Officer (COO).
Babayan brings over two decades of leadership in enterprise transformation, cybersecurity, and complex programme delivery across the financial services and technology sectors. He has led major initiatives at Deutsche Bank, Barclays, UBS, and Kantar, delivering large-scale digital transformation programmes, embedding SaaS and AI technologies, and building high-performing cross-functional teams.
